I filed a motion to make the father pay for 1/2 room and board costs as stated in the divorce decree. The key is my daughter is living with me and going to a community college. We also have another teenage daughter. His lawyer wants to have child support re-evaluated. I don't think that is right because the decree specifically address many elements of child support not defined in 1996, the year of the divorce. My question is, can the judge re-evaluate child support and over-rule the percentages identified for health care and room & board costs?
